IAccPropServer.GetPropValue(Byte, UInt32, Guid, Object, Int32) Método
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
O IAccPropServer e todos os seus membros expostos fazem parte de um wrapper gerenciado para a interface IAccPropServer
COM (Component Object Model).
public:
void GetPropValue(System::Byte % pIDString, System::UInt32 dwIDStringLen, Guid idProp, [Runtime::InteropServices::Out] System::Object ^ % pvarValue, [Runtime::InteropServices::Out] int % pfHasProp);
public void GetPropValue (ref byte pIDString, uint dwIDStringLen, Guid idProp, out object pvarValue, out int pfHasProp);
abstract member GetPropValue : byte * uint32 * Guid * obj * int -> unit
Public Sub GetPropValue (ByRef pIDString As Byte, dwIDStringLen As UInteger, idProp As Guid, ByRef pvarValue As Object, ByRef pfHasProp As Integer)
Parâmetros
- pIDString
- Byte
Contém uma cadeia de caracteres que identifica a propriedade que está sendo solicitada.
- dwIDStringLen
- UInt32
Especifica o comprimento da cadeia de caracteres de identidade especificada pelo parâmetro pIDString
.
- idProp
- Guid
Especifica um GUID que indica a propriedade desejada.
- pvarValue
- Object
Especifica o valor da propriedade substituída. Este parâmetro será válido somente se pfHasProp
for TRUE. O servidor deverá definir isso como VT_EMPTY se pfHasProp
estiver definido como FALSE.
- pfHasProp
- Int32
Indica se o servidor está fornecendo um valor para a propriedade solicitada. O servidor deverá definir isso como TRUE se estiver retornando uma propriedade de substituição ou como FALSE se ele não estiver retornando uma propriedade (neste caso, ele também deve definir pvarValue
como VT_EMPTY).
Comentários
Para obter mais informações sobre IAccPropServer, consulte IAccPropServer::GetPropValue.